There is no fuse for the antenna itself but it's wired to the radio. Does your radio work? There is a fuse for that under the hood and also by the driver's kick plate. More likely the antenna motor is dead - a common problem for the 4th gens. You can remove the antenna motor and test it by hooking it up to a 12V battery.
